Hi-visibilty WWII Cdn Jeep
 
Came across this image recently. Note the white-painted details includingh the rear marker light and the hand grabs. The photo was taken in the immediate post-war era and the Jeep is from the Canadian Army Film & Photo Unit. The Jeep in the background has used a white tarp on the cowl to protect against scratches from the camera's tripod.
